Splodgenessabounds photo

Splodgenessabounds concerts in London, United Kingdom

Splodgenessabounds has played in London, United Kingdom 14 out of 46 concerts, with a probability of 30.43% to hosts a show there, since his debut on Bridge House on May 14, 1980 until his latest show on New Cross Inn on September 23, 2023